We are looking for a Robotics QA/QC Engineer to own hands‑on validation and testing of robotic systems in controlled environments at our Irvine facility.
In this role, you will work directly with robots, monitor system behavior, identify issues, and ensure reliable and safe operation prior to deployment. You will collaborate closely with engineering teams to surface bugs, validate fixes, and improve overall system quality.
This is a highly practical, execution‑focused role where you will be deeply involved in day‑to‑day testing and validation of physical systems. If you enjoy working with hardware, troubleshooting in real time, and being the final quality gate before systems ship, this role is for you.
